Uh, no. I always have a solid 3g signal, and my battery life is much improved on wifi. Same on every phone i have ever had.
It takes far less current to send a signal a short distance to the wifi router than it does to send a signal to the nearest tower, which could be a mile away.
I would think a campus wide wifi network will use more battery than being in the same room/house as the AP, like most of us are used to. depending on the 3g signal on campus and the wifi's strength and interference levels, the only real way to tell is try both out over a few days and see whats best for you.
